David Smith (Beechwood Village City Council At-large, Kentucky, candidate 2024)
David Smith ran for election to the Beechwood Village City Council At-large in Kentucky. Smith was a write-in candidate in the general election on November 5, 2024.[source]

General election for Beechwood Village City Council At-large (6 seats)
George Allison, Mary Ellen Baker, Glenn Francisco, Theresa G. Prestigiacomo, and David Smith ran in the general election for Beechwood Village City Council At-large on November 5, 2024.
